Hudly wireless

Hudly Wireless helps you stay connected while driving, reducing stress and casting important information in your line-of-sight. Navigation to speed: You will always have the speed and navigation information you need. You can now focus on driving, not worrying about your smartphone. Here's how this works:

The Hudly Wireless, a rectangular box measuring seven by five by two inches, is attached to the base at about two inches. The black plastic shell attaches to the dash by using a removable adhesive. The device is not too bulky and can be placed on any dashboard, but it's difficult to fit it above the steering wheel. Hudly can be placed in a central place on the dashboard.


Hudly's other handy feature is the ability to project your phone's screen onto you dashboard. You can use your favorite apps and navigation with it. It measures 6.2 inches. That's large enough to see clearly even in wide angles. It works with almost all Android tablets and phones. It has a full 800x480 resolution. It doesn't need to be connected to your car's OBD port so it is easy for you to install.

HudlyLite

This $59 car accessory beams speed and RPM information onto the windshield. This lightweight, compact device is powered by the ignition and has built-in sensors to keep the device secure. It also includes an automatic chime, and a rubber mounting to hold it in position. If you have a leadfoot or older driver, the Hudly Lite may be a great solution. Although speedometer readings vary depending on vehicle manufacturer settings, the Hudly Lite provides calibrated readings.

OBD2 ports are likely to be present in any gas-powered vehicle. OBD2 is an acronym for Onboard Built In Diagnosis. Modern cars all have this port. The Hudly Lite, a head up display designed for driving on roads, can be connected here. While most cars have HUDs, these are typically found only in luxury cars, but the Hudly Lite offers many of the same benefits for a much lower cost.

Statistics

  • 52% of Mechanics in the United States think their salaries are enough for the cost of living in their area. (indeed.com)
  • There were 749,900 jobs available for automotive service technicians and mechanics in 2016, which is expected to grow by six percent through 2026. (jobhero.com)
  • The U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S) reports that the job outlook for automotive service technicians and mechanics is expected to decline by 4% from 2019 to 2029. (indeed.com)
